Two companies creating digital technologies for neurological conditions are collaborating on augmented reality and artificial intelligence in diagnostics. Financial and intellectual property details of the agreement between <a href=\"https:\/\/altoida.com\/\">Altoida Inc.<\/a> in Washington, D.C. and <a href=\"https:\/\/clicktherapeutics.com\/\">Click Therapeutics Inc.<\/a> in New York are not disclosed.<\/p>\n<p>Altoida develops <a href=\"https:\/\/altoida.com\/company\/\">assessments of cognitive performance<\/a> to reveal indicators of brain health, packaged as smartphone and tablet apps. The company&#8217;s process uses exercises with <a href=\"https:\/\/altoida.com\/product\/\">immersive augmented reality<\/a> games to portray daily life activities. The company says individuals&#8217; responses to these exercises are scored for cognitive and motor skill indicators, with the collection of exercises taking only 10 minutes. The exercises are designed to measure cognitive and functional abilities, with A.I. algorithms used to correlate results to clinical and real-world indicators of brain health.<\/p>\n<p>A recent study of 148 individuals, divided between 58 healthy persons and 90 in various stages of Alzheimer&#8217;s disease, evaluated Altoida&#8217;s digital measures against today&#8217;s clinical assessment questionnaires. Altoida conducted the study with the Innovative Medicines Initiative, and findings posted on the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.medrxiv.org\/content\/10.1101\/2021.11.07.21265705v2\">medRxiv pre-publication server<\/a> in November 2021 are not yet peer-reviewed. Results show Altoida&#8217;s augmented reality test scores correlate with clinical questionnaire assessments, and better differentiate between Alzheimer&#8217;s disease stages than conventional questionnaires.<\/p>\n<h4>Develop more sensitive measures of cognition<\/h4>\n<p>Click Therapeutics creates <a href=\"https:\/\/clicktherapeutics.com\/digital-therapeutics\/\">software for treating neurological conditions<\/a> based on artificial intelligence and data science. The company&#8217;s <a href=\"https:\/\/clicktherapeutics.com\/products\/\">software pipeline<\/a> includes therapies for disorders such as major depression and schizophrenia, as well as treatments for smoking cessation, insomnia, migraine, and other pain.
